Ethereum is currently experiencing a bullish sentiment, with many analysts predicting a potential rally of up to 25%. This optimistic outlook comes as the largest holders of ETH, often referred to as “whales,” have recently returned to a profitable state, reigniting interest in the second-largest cryptocurrency by market capitalization.

The resurgence of these wealthy investors is particularly noteworthy given the volatility that has characterized the crypto market in recent months. After enduring significant price fluctuations, Ethereum whales appear to be capitalizing on the recent price movements to reclaim their positions. Data shows that many of these large holders are now seeing gains on their investments, which could lead to increased buying pressure as they look to expand their holdings further.

Market indicators suggest that Ethereum’s price may soon break through critical resistance levels, potentially setting the stage for a significant upward movement. This aligns with broader trends in the crypto market, where renewed investor interest and institutional adoption are driving prices higher across various digital assets. With Ethereum’s ongoing transition to a proof-of-stake model and the upcoming upgrades designed to enhance scalability and efficiency, many experts believe that the asset is well-positioned for future growth.

Additionally, the overall market sentiment has improved, with Bitcoin also showing signs of recovery. The correlation between Ethereum and Bitcoin suggests that a bullish trend in one could influence the other. As retail investors observe the actions of these whales, they may be encouraged to re-enter the market, further amplifying the potential for a rally.

In conclusion, with ETH whales back in the game and the market showing signs of a positive shift, Ethereum could be on the brink of a significant price surge.
